Mayacamas, Napa Valley, Mt. Veeder, Cabernet Sauvignon 1983 (HS) Bordeaux Rouge including the wines Mondavi wasremoved from Original Carton; High Shoulder or better 92 points John Gilman . . . . the Mayacamas 83 is excellent. At age twenty four the bouquet is quite Pichon Lalande like, as it offers up notes of sweet cassis, tobacco, coffee, bell pepper, earth and cigar smoke. On the palate the wine is medium full, poised and complex, with lovely focus and purity and a long, tangy and highly polished finish . . . . it lacks for nothing in its more understated
